From the How it Works tab of the link I already posted:

Duke Stars are typically offered on a forum thread when the original author of the thread wants to encourage active participation and solicit timely answers to their questions. Not every forum posting or thread will offer the opportunity to earn Duke Stars.

When a user starts a new thread, he has the option to offer up to 10 Duke Stars to respondents. Forums users earn Duke Stars for their own account by responding to threads that offer Duke Stars as rewards. The thread author determines which response merits the reward, and has full discretion over which respondent is awarded the Duke Stars. The thread author can split the Duke Stars amongst the posters whose answers he found most helpful, but cannot award himself.
